While driving my car a few days ago the speedo jumped around and then stopped working, as this happened my car made a loud bang and went into limp mode. The following day it worked fine and has done until today when the speedo died and the car went straight into limp mode. I disconnected the battery for 30 mins and on reconnection got about 1 kilometer down the road before it happened again. When it happens. the ODO OFF light flashes on and off. I can still reverse no problem.

The car is a Terios DX, year 2000 with 105900 on the clock. Its an automatic 4X4 4 speed. It recently had a service and the oil and fluid were changed.

I have looked into this online and see that there may be many reasons for the problem. Just wondered if someone can give me advice. I'm not very mechanical Sad

Most likely the speed sensor

Most likely the speed sensor as this provides both the ECU and the speedo with a signal, being an auto means it relies on the speed sensor to work in conjunction with other sensors for the engine management system to work correctly, and to provide the gearbox ECU with the correct information so it works effectively, and onviously the ABS and traction control if its fitted.

Theres only one way to identify the problem, have the ECU read for fault codes and this should confirm things.

It could be the sensor itself, the wiring damaged, the connections at the plugs corroded, or even damp in the plugs or wiring.

Buy a cheap-ish OBD code

Buy a cheap-ish OBD code reader (iso 14230 kwp2000) and see what it may say. Well worth the £35-£80 spent on one, that's what Garages would charge just to tell you anyway, plus you still have it for future reads or sell on to cut your losses Smile

When I say loud bang, I mean

When I say loud bang, I mean it's like a bang as if the car has stalled but it doesn't ever stall, just makes this bang and jerks then limp mode then a bang/jerk into 3rd and then back into revving high and limp mode. If you think of being in a dodgem when you hit into another dodgem at the fair ground-same feeling. It's the fact that it comes and goes like it struggles and then the speedo jumps back into life and off we go happy as Larry.. But only for a few kn's and we go back into dead speedo/limp mode. Could this be the transmission computer module?
